Michael S. Brown, MD, has been a Director of Regeneron "since June 1991. Dr. Brown holds the Distinguished Chair in Biomedical Sciences, a position he has held since 1989, is a Regental Professor of Molecular Genetics and Internal Medicine and the Director of the Erik Jonsson Center for Molecular Genetics and Human Disease at the University of Texas Southwestern Medical Center at Dallas, positions he has held since 1985. Dr. Brown and Dr. Joseph Goldstein jointly received the Nobel Prize for Physiology or Medicine in 1985 and the U.S. National Medal of Science in 1988. Dr. Brown is a member of the National Academy of Sciences, the Institute of Medicine and Foreign Member of the Royal Society (London). Dr. Brown served as a member of the Board of Directors of Pfizer Inc. until April 2012." [1]
